Wednesday is expected to reach a high of 81 degrees under mostly sunny skies in Denver, the National Weather Service said.

The dry, warm weather is forecast to bring slight breezes, expected to reach between 5 and 8 mph, the weather service said. Temperatures will drop to an overnight low of 57 degrees.

Thursday is expected to bring a jump in temperature up to a high of 90 degrees, with a slight chance off showers and thunderstorms in the afternoon.

The rest of the week is forecast to be calm, dry and hot, with Friday reaching a high of 90 degrees with sunny weather. The sunny skies are expected to continue as the temperatures heat up to a high of 94 degrees both Saturday and Sunday.
